Beyond the numbers

What each city asks you to trade

Costs and scores help narrow the choice. These practical strengths and limitations finish the picture.

Izmir Turkey

Strengths

  • Affordable cost of living
  • Rich history and vibrant culture
  • Delicious local cuisine
  • Beautiful Aegean coastline
  • Friendly local community
  • Mild Mediterranean climate

Trade-offs

  • Language barrier outside tourist areas
  • Bureaucracy for residence permits
  • Rising inflation affecting prices
  • Traffic congestion during peak hours
  • Limited high-speed coworking spaces
  • Air quality can be moderate in summer

Common visa routes

  • e-Visa for 90 days
  • Tourist visa extension possible
  • Residence permit for long stays
Nicosia Cyprus

Strengths

  • Affordable cost of living compared to Western Europe
  • Excellent Mediterranean climate with mild winters
  • Good English proficiency among locals and expats
  • Low crime rate and high safety index
  • Central location for exploring Europe, Middle East, and Africa
  • Modern coworking spaces and reliable fiber internet

Trade-offs

  • Summers can be extremely hot and humid
  • Public transport is limited and infrequent
  • Bureaucracy can be slow for residency paperwork
  • Island life can feel isolating for some
  • Nightlife is modest outside the university area
  • Rental prices have been rising in popular neighborhoods

Common visa routes

  • Visa-free (up to 90 days)
  • Digital nomad visa (Cyprus)
  • Student visa
